Thanks for the help.This is a gamerip, so the sample rate of the music is just like the original, which is something like 27Khz, or something like that.
Anyway, Apple software is notorious for being incapable of playing music files with different sample rates. So it will work on any player, because basically every player supports different sample rates, except iTunes.
